数组概述 数组是用来存储同一种数据类型多个元素的容器。 数据类型:可以是基本数据类型,也可以是引用数据类型。 容器:比如说纸箱,衣柜,教室等,可以存放多个事务。直接输出数组名,得到的是数组的内存地址值。 数组中未手动赋值(初始化)的元素,是有默认值的。例如:int型默认值是0,double默认值是0.0,String默认值是null 数组的长度:数组名.length 数组的最大索引:数组长度-1数
转载
2023-09-19 10:16:11
39阅读
## 如何在Java中表示JSON数组
作为一名经验丰富的开发者,你需要教导一位刚入行的小白如何在Java中表示JSON数组。这是一个基础但重要的知识点,对于Web开发和后端开发都非常有用。下面我将详细介绍整个过程,并给出具体的代码示例。
### 步骤概述
首先,让我们先来看看表示JSON数组的整个流程。我们可以用以下表格展示每个步骤:
| 步骤 | 操作 |
| ----- | ----
原创
2024-04-17 06:13:38
35阅读
首先我们要明白java中的集合Collection,List,ArrayList之间的关系:ArrayList是具体的实现类,实现了List接口List是接口,继承了Collection接口List继承了Collection接口 但是List是可以重复的并且有序的集合 Collection是不可重复且无序的这里我们先讲一下List集合:List接口不能被构造 也就是我们说的
转载
2023-09-05 19:11:45
29阅读
1.数组类型 数组是编程语言中最常见的一种数据结构,可用于储存多个数据,每个数据元素存放一个数据,通常可以通过数组元素的索引来访问数组元素,包括为数组元素赋值和取出数组元素的值。 Java的数组既可以存储基本类型的数据,也可以存储引用类型的数据。值得指出的是:数组也是一种数据类型,它本身是一种引用类型。在任何已有类型后加上方括号[ ],又变成一种新类型,这种类型统称为数组类型,所有的数组类型又
转载
2023-06-15 20:16:08
110阅读
空数组即下标为0的数组,如a[0]。在函数中声明空数组是没有任何意义的,当然也编译不过。而在类或结构体中,是可以这样声明的。 struct ast_exten {
char *exten;
char stuff[0];
};
又如:
struct ast_include {
char *name;
char *rname;
转载
2023-12-19 19:31:15
38阅读
** 1.数组(Array):** 在Java中,数组(Array)分为一维数组和二维数组。存出一组同一个数据类型的容器叫做数组。 数组对每一个存入的数据都会进行自动排序,而排序从零开始,这个编号就叫做下标。数组的长度是固定不可变的。.2格式: 声明数组的格式有三种 第一种 : 数据类型[] 数组名 = new 数据类型[数组存放的个数],这种格式适用于一些知道元素的个数,但是 不知道具体元素值得
转载
2023-07-17 22:19:54
72阅读
数组1、概述1.1 定义数组是一组数据的集合,数组中的每个数组被称为元素。例如:下面这串代码可以直接用数组来表示int a1 = 1;
int a2 = 2;
int a3 = 3;
int a4 = 4;数组表示:int[] arr = {1,2,3,4); //用数组来保存了这四个数据。在java中,数组也可以看成是个对象,数组中的元素可以为任意类型(基本类型或者引用类型),但同一个数组里只
转载
2023-08-29 22:20:03
84阅读
数组是指一组数据的集合,数组中的每个数据被称作元素。在数组中可以存放任意类型的元素,但同一个数组里存放的元素类型必须一致概念同一种类型数据的集合。其实数组就是一个容器。数组的好处可以自动给数组中的元素从0开始编号,方便操作这些元素。数组的定义在Java中,可以使用以下格式来定义一个数组。如下:数据类型[] 数组名 = new 数据类型[元素个数或数组长度];例:1 int[] x = new in
转载
2023-05-23 20:37:45
102阅读
概念:一组连续的存储空间,存储多个相同数据类型的数据语法1.声明数组 数据类型[] 数组名; int[] a; int []a; int a[];
2.分配空间 数组名 = new 数据类型[数组长度]; a = new int[4];1)多种声明方式
声明的同时并且分配空间 int [] a = new int[4];
显示初始化
int [] a = new int [] {1,
众所周知,坐标系有一维、二维、三维,Java中数组也不例外,像一维数组、二维数组,下面就数组来说下相关知识。 先通过简单的案例来熟悉数组: (1)任务:实现二维数组的行列互换 (2)准备工作:二维数组的初始化、定义 (3)编程:public class ArrayCh
转载
2023-06-07 20:16:35
45阅读
## 如何在MySQL中表示数组
作为一名经验丰富的开发者,你可能会遇到一些刚入行的小白不知道如何在MySQL中表示数组的问题。在本文中,我将向你介绍如何实现这一功能,帮助你更好地理解和应用。
### 流程图
```mermaid
flowchart TD
A[创建表] --> B[插入数据]
B --> C[查询数据]
```
### 步骤
首先,让我们来看一下整个流程
原创
2024-07-04 04:55:29
21阅读
数组(一)【案例引导】 现在需要统计某公司员工的工资情况,例如计算平均工资、最高工资等。假设该公司50 名员工,用前面所学的知识,程序首先需要声明50个变量来分别记录每位员工的这样做 会显得很麻烦。在Java中,可以使用一个数组来记住这50名员工的工资。数组是指一组数据的集合,数组中的每个数据被称作元素。数组可以存放任意类型的元素,但同一个数组里存放的元素类型必须一致。数组可分为一维数组和多维数组
转载
2024-05-14 15:56:38
26阅读
数组是编程语言中最常见的一种数据结构,可用于存储多个数据。Java的数组要求所有的数组元素具有相同的数据类型,Java的数组既可以用来存储基本类型的数据,也可以用来存储引用类型的数据,只要所有的数组元素具有相同的类型即可。一旦数组的初始化完成,数组在内存中所占的空间将被固定下来,因此数组的长度将不可改变。 一、定义数组  
转载
2023-06-15 16:16:58
49阅读
# JavaScript 数组表示
## 引言
作为一名经验丰富的开发者,我将向您介绍如何在 JavaScript 中表示数组。对于刚入行的小白来说,理解数组的概念和如何使用它们是非常重要的。在本文中,我将引导您通过整个过程,并提供每个步骤所需的代码和解释。
## 数组表示的流程
下面是表示数组的过程的一个简单示意表格:
| 步骤 | 描述 |
| --- | --- |
| 1 | 创
原创
2023-08-07 12:13:14
37阅读
1、什么是ArrayList ArrayList就是传说中的动态数组,用MSDN中的说法,就是Array的复杂版本,它提供了如下一些好处: 动态的增加和减少元素 实现了ICollection和IList接口 灵活的设置数组的大小2、如何使用ArrayList 最简单的例子: ArrayList List = new ArrayList();
for( int i=0;i <10;i++
# Java返回空数组的表示方法
在Java编程中,我们经常需要处理数组,包括空数组。空数组指的是数组的长度为0,不包含任何元素。在Java中,返回空数组有多种方式,本文将详细介绍这些方法,并提供代码示例。
## 一、直接声明空数组
最直接的方法是在代码中直接声明一个空数组。这种方式简单明了,适用于所有场景。
```java
int[] emptyArray = new int[0];
`
原创
2024-07-30 05:43:17
89阅读
# Java数组的地址表示及实际应用
在Java编程中,数组是一种重要的数据结构,用于存储多个相同类型的数据。理解如何表示Java数组的地址,对于优化性能和避免内存泄漏非常关键。本文将探讨Java数组的地址表示,并结合一个实际问题进行示例分析。
## 什么是Java数组的地址?
在Java中,数组是一种对象,每个数组都有一个内存地址。这个地址可以帮助程序访问和操作数组中的元素。当我们创建一个
# Java中的数组长度表示及其应用
在Java编程中,数组是一种常见的数据结构,用于存储固定大小的同类型元素。理解如何表示和使用数组的长度对于有效管理和操作数据至关重要。本文将通过一个实际问题,演示如何在Java中正确获取数组的长度,并附上代码示例。
## 数组长度的表示
在Java中,每个数组都有一个内置的属性——`length`,该属性用于表示数组的长度。需要注意的是,这个位数并不是一
### Java数组不为空的表示方法
在Java中,数组是一种常见的数据结构,用于存储固定大小的元素集合。数组可以是基本数据类型(如int、char等)或引用数据类型(如String、Object等)。当我们谈论“数组不为空”时,这通常指的是两件事情:第一,数组本身不为`null`;第二,数组的长度大于0。
接下来,我们将详细介绍如何判断数组是否不为空,同时给出相关的代码示例,并阐述其应用场景
java中数组长度为零和为空的区别
转载
2023-06-05 21:56:48
121阅读